-
React Antd Card组件列表显示异常:苹果浏览器下为何出现“透明”效果?(组件.异常.浏览器.透明.苹果.....)
react antd card组件列表显示异常:苹果浏览器下的“透明”视觉错觉 在使用React Antd框架构建Card组件列表时,特别是使用Card tabs进行内容分类展示,可能会遇到一个在苹果浏览器下出现的奇怪问题:当列表项数量超过一定值(例如5个)时,Card tabs组件会出现类似透明的视觉效果。 此问题并非组件本身的透明化,而是内容溢出导致的视觉错觉。苹果浏览器的渲染机制在此情况下可能会产生这种效果。 问题根源在于列表项内容超出Card tabs容器的宽度,导...
作者:wufei123 日期:2025.03.13 分类:html 0 -
图片右对齐却占据空间?如何用CSS定位技巧完美解决?(如何用.占据.定位.完美.解决.....)
css定位技巧:巧妙解决图片右对齐占据空间的问题 网页布局中,常遇到图片右对齐却占据额外空间的问题,导致文本排列错乱。本文通过一个案例,讲解如何运用CSS定位技巧完美解决此问题。 问题:使用float: right;实现图片右对齐效果不佳。 外层容器采用margin: 0 auto;水平居中,图片使用负right值尝试右移,但由于浮动元素仍占据空间,导致文本换行。 解决方案:放弃浮动,改用绝对定位。将父元素设置为position: relative;,图片容器设置为pos...
作者:wufei123 日期:2025.03.13 分类:html 0 -
如何用CSS实现背景图片与渐变效果的完美融合?(渐变.如何用.背景图片.融合.效果.....)
巧妙运用css打造背景图片与渐变的完美视觉效果 在网页设计中,同时运用背景图片和渐变效果,能创造出令人惊艳的视觉效果。本文将深入探讨如何使用CSS实现这一目标,并解答一些常见问题。 许多开发者尝试直接在背景图片上叠加渐变,但CSS并不原生支持这种方法。 这通常会导致结果与预期不符。 有效的解决方案是利用CSS的filter属性,特别是结合SVG矢量图。filter属性允许我们对SVG图片应用各种图像特效,包括渐变。 通过调整filter属性中的参数,我们可以精确控制渐变的...
作者:wufei123 日期:2025.03.13 分类:html 0 -
如何用CSS只显示左右渐变边框?(渐变.只显示.边框.如何用.CSS.....)
css渐变边框技巧:打造左右渐变视觉效果 网页设计中,渐变边框能有效提升视觉吸引力。然而,只实现左右渐变,而非全方位渐变,却常常让开发者头疼。本文将详细讲解如何解决这个问题,并提供一种巧妙的CSS方案。 许多开发者尝试使用border-image属性结合linear-gradient实现左右渐变,但效果不尽如人意。这是因为线性渐变的方向与border-image的切片方式冲突,导致渐变色出现在了上下边框。 为了解决这个问题,我们可以利用radial-gradient (径向...
作者:wufei123 日期:2025.03.13 分类:html 0 -
图片靠右对齐却占据空间?如何解决浮动元素影响网页布局?(如何解决.浮动.布局.占据.元素.....)
图片靠右对齐却占据空间?巧妙解决浮动元素影响网页布局! 在网页设计中,我们经常需要将图片靠右对齐,并让文字环绕在图片周围。然而,使用float: right;属性后,图片有时仍会占据其原本的空间,导致布局混乱。本文将分析此问题,并提供有效的解决方案。 问题描述: 假设我们希望将图片置于右侧,并让文本环绕显示。使用了float: right;,但图片仍然占据空间,文本无法正常排列。代码示例如下: HTML: <div id="father">...
作者:wufei123 日期:2025.03.13 分类:html 0 -
CSS绝对定位子元素如何完全占据父元素内容区域(含padding)?(元素.位子.占据.区域.内容.....)
本文探讨css布局中,如何让绝对定位的子元素完美贴合父元素内容区域(包含padding)。 许多开发者遇到这样的问题:父元素设置了padding,绝对定位的子元素宽度设为100%,却无法完全填充父元素的内部区域。 问题: 父元素使用相对定位并设置padding,子元素绝对定位且宽度为100%。预期子元素占据父元素内容区域(padding内部),但实际结果是子元素宽度包含了padding。 代码示例: <div class="container"...
作者:wufei123 日期:2025.03.13 分类:html 0 -
如何用CSS只实现网页元素左右两侧的渐变边框效果?(渐变.边框.如何用.元素.效果.....)
css渐变边框:只显示左右两侧的技巧 许多前端开发者都希望在网页设计中运用渐变边框来提升视觉效果。本文将深入探讨如何利用CSS只在网页元素的左右两侧创建渐变边框,并分析常见错误及解决方案。 文中给出了一个尝试使用border-image属性结合线性渐变linear-gradient实现渐变边框的例子: border-image: linear-gradient(rgba(255, 255, 255, 0.00) 0%, #00BBF2 20%, rgba(255, 255,...
作者:wufei123 日期:2025.03.13 分类:html 1 -
Vue.js条件渲染页面闪烁:如何用v-cloak指令解决?(如何用.渲染.指令.闪烁.条件.....)
vue.js 条件渲染中的页面闪烁问题及解决方案 在使用 Vue.js 进行开发时,常常会遇到利用 v-if 和 v-else 进行条件渲染的情况。然而,初次加载页面时,有时会出现短暂的闪烁现象,即在最终渲染结果显示之前,会先显示未渲染的 DOM 结构,影响用户体验。 这篇文章将针对这个问题,探讨其原因并提供有效的解决方法。 问题描述: 正如读者所遇到的情况,在使用 v-if 和 v-else 进行条件渲染时,页面加载过程中可能会出现短暂的闪烁。这主要是因为在 Vue 实例...
作者:wufei123 日期:2025.03.13 分类:html 1 -
IE浏览器下图片和文字如何实现垂直居中?(居中.垂直.如何实现.浏览器.文字.....)
ie浏览器图片与文字垂直居中显示的css兼容性解决方案 在网页设计中,图片与文字的垂直居中对齐常常是一个挑战,尤其是在IE浏览器中。本文将分析一个实际案例,并提供在IE浏览器下实现图片和文字垂直居中的CSS兼容性解决方案。 问题: 用户希望两张图片和一段文字在页面上垂直居中显示,但在IE浏览器中,文字未能正确居中。 用户尝试使用top属性,但效果不理想。 解决方案: 避免使用top属性,改用display: inline-block和vertical-align: mid...
作者:wufei123 日期:2025.03.13 分类:html 0 -
如何在Stylus中优雅地添加自定义字体而不覆盖原有字体?(字体.而不.自定义.优雅.覆盖.....)
在stylus中优雅地添加自定义字体,避免覆盖原有字体 许多开发者在使用CSS时,需要在现有字体列表中添加自定义字体,而不会覆盖原有字体设置。本文介绍如何使用Stylus和JavaScript实现这一目标,保持代码简洁易维护。 假设网页已设置font-family: -apple-system, BlinkMacSystemFont;,而开发者希望在前面添加自定义字体my-custom(通过@font-face规则定义)。直接覆盖font-family属性会丢失原有字体,因此...
作者:wufei123 日期:2025.03.13 分类:html 0